Unsuccessful applications
If your application is unsuccessful you will receive a letter stating why you have not met the selection prerequisites or that quotas have been filled.
Other RMIT study options can be considered and you should contact RMIT International Services for advice on the following:
- meeting the academic selection requirements by, for example, completing a preparatory program such as Foundation Studies before being accepted into your preferred diploma or bachelor degree program
- choosing a different program in a similar field with prerequisites list you can meet
- finding a similar program at a different study level. For example look at RMIT’s diploma program prerequisites as an alternative to a bachelor degree program. RMIT offers many programs that can be pathways to higher level studies. Many RMIT diploma programs give credit towards degree programs.
